Sloan, G. (2012) Haldane's Mackindergarten: a radical experiment in British military education. War in History, 19 (3). pp. 322-352. ISSN 1477-0385 doi: 10.1177/0968344512440399
Abstract/Summary
This article critically evaluates a course that was conceived and run at the LSE by Sir Halford Mackinder for officers of the Britsh Army between 1907 and 1932.There is an examination of the nature of the syllabus,the aims and objectives of this course.An explanation is also given as to why the army cut it seven years before the outbreak of the Second World War.
